Magrahat College, established in 1996, is an affiliated college located in South 24 Parganas, West Bengal. Spanning over 4. 29 acres, this institution has served for more than two decades. As of now, it has a student enrolment of 5,096 in total, while the faculty comprises 32 dedicated teachers.
The institution has taken pride in the availability of a variety of facilities that help enrich the learning experience of its students. Occupying the central place among the facilities is the Central Library, comprising a stock of books numbering around 14,000, classified based on the Dewey Decimal System.
It also subscribes to various journals, periodicals, and newspapers, such as Employment News and Karmakshetra, which are related to careers. The sports facility and gym are also available for the students who believe in physical fitness. There is a well-equipped modern IT infrastructure on campus, thereby providing the students with the latest technological support for their studies.
It caters to the needs of staff and students with regard to culinary requirements, refreshment, and socialising. Magrahat College also houses well-equipped laboratories for practical learning and also an auditorium that has served as a venue for events and seminars.
Magrahat College offers as many as 8 different courses under 2 degree programs, where the principal constituent happens to be the arts and humanities stream.
